UAE imposes travel ban to Iran, Lebanon and Iraq

01 May 2026 09:14

The United Arab Emirates has imposed a travel ban on its citizens to Iran, Lebanon, and Iraq, as authorities move to safeguard nationals amid ongoing regional developments.

In a statement issued on Thursday night, April 30, the Ministry of Foreign Affairs confirmed that UAE nationals are prohibited from travelling to the three countries until further notice.

The ministry also called on Emiratis currently in Iran, Lebanon, and Iraq to “expedite their immediate return” to the UAE.

The decision is part of what the ministry described as ongoing efforts to monitor the well-being of UAE citizens abroad and to respond proactively to evolving geopolitical risks.

MoFA further urged all UAE nationals to adhere to official travel advisories and instructions strictly

As an additional precaution, citizens currently in Iran, Lebanon, and Iraq have been instructed to register with the ministry and make contact via its dedicated hotline number: +97180044444.
